前端编程实战构建高效且美观的Web界面

jdzs238 · · 248 次点击 · 开始浏览    置顶
这是一个创建于 的主题,其中的信息可能已经有所发展或是发生改变。

构建高效美观的Web界面需明确设计目标,选合适框架与工具,优化性能,关注可访问性,注重用户体验,持续迭代优化。设计目标影响方向,框架工具提高效率,性能优化加速响应,可访问性保障普适,用户体验提升满意度,持续迭代保持领先。 在数字化时代,Web界面作为用户与互联网交互的桥梁,其重要性不言而喻。一个高效且美观的Web界面不仅能提升用户体验,还能为网站或应用创造巨大的商业价值。本文将从实战角度出发,探讨如何构建高效且美观的Web界面。 一、明确设计目标 在开始前端编程之前,首先要明确设计目标。这包括了解用户需求、分析竞品、确定功能定位以及设定设计风格等。明确的设计目标有助于我们更好地把握项目方向,为后续的开发工作奠定基础。 二、选择合适的框架与工具 选择一个适合项目的框架和工具至关重要。例如,React、Vue和Angular等主流前端框架各有优劣,我们需要根据项目需求、团队技术栈以及个人喜好来做出选择。同时,还可以借助Webpack、Babel等工具进行模块打包、代码转换等操作,提高开发效率。 三、优化性能 性能优化是构建高效Web界面的关键。我们可以从以下几个方面入手: 1. 减少HTTP请求:通过合并CSS、JavaScript文件,使用CSS Sprite、Iconfont等技术,减少页面加载时的HTTP请求次数。 2. 压缩资源:利用Gzip、Brotli等压缩算法对HTML、CSS、JavaScript等资源进行压缩,减小文件体积,加快传输速度。 3. 缓存策略:通过设置HTTP缓存头、使用CDN等技术,提高资源加载速度,减少用户等待时间。 4. 异步加载:利用异步加载技术,如Ajax、Fetch等,实现页面内容的动态加载,提高页面响应速度。 四、关注可访问性 构建美观的Web界面时,我们还需要关注可访问性。这意味着要确保界面在各种设备和浏览器上都能正常显示和运行,同时还需要考虑视觉障碍用户的需求。例如,我们可以使用语义化标签、提供键盘操作支持、设置合适的颜色和对比度等,以提高界面的可访问性。xjcz2019.robot-china.com 五、注重用户体验 用户体验是衡量Web界面质量的重要指标。为了提升用户体验,我们可以从以下几个方面着手: 1. 简洁明了的设计:避免过多的视觉元素和复杂的交互流程,保持界面简洁明了,让用户能够快速理解和使用。 2. 一致的交互方式:保持界面中的交互方式一致,让用户能够轻松掌握操作方法,降低学习成本。 3. 明确的反馈:在用户进行操作时,提供明确的反馈,如按钮点击后的状态变化、表单提交后的提示信息等,帮助用户了解操作结果。 4. 响应式设计:适应不同设备和屏幕尺寸的响应式设计,确保用户在不同场景下都能获得良好的体验。 wuhai785.robot-china.com 六、持续迭代与优化 Web界面的构建并非一蹴而就,需要我们在实际使用过程中不断迭代和优化。通过收集用户反馈、分析数据指标、调整设计方案等手段,持续改进界面功能和用户体验,让Web界面始终保持高效且美观。 zuxna.robot-china.com 总之,构建高效且美观的Web界面需要我们在设计、开发、优化等多个环节付出努力。通过明确设计目标、选择合适的框架与工具、优化性能、关注可访问性、注重用户体验以及持续迭代与优化等方法,我们可以为用户打造一个既实用又美观的Web界面。

有疑问加站长微信联系(非本文作者)

入群交流(和以上内容无关):加入Go大咖交流群,或添加微信:liuxiaoyan-s 备注:入群;或加QQ群:692541889

248 次点击  
加入收藏 微博
暂无回复
添加一条新回复 (您需要 登录 后才能回复 没有账号 ?)
  • 请尽量让自己的回复能够对别人有帮助
  • 支持 Markdown 格式, **粗体**、~~删除线~~、`单行代码`
  • 支持 @ 本站用户;支持表情(输入 : 提示),见 Emoji cheat sheet
  • 图片支持拖拽、截图粘贴等方式上传